Transaction caef6d02a66ac3e862408145889237bec84c0251a021ea6345c30f80b7bc380e
1 Input
1 Output
-
caef6d02a66ac3e862408145889237bec84c0251a021ea6345c30f80b7bc380e:0
- value
- 459284
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6de9a3ea04566fc7f12f9bdb0028d76e03f07ea OP_EQUAL
- address
- 3MH9CHkNKUsS3nefyVW3KBQ6yxRuGpYWsU